I have had the pleasure of getting my car on top of a concrete wall and sliding along it for a fair distance with a pair of flaggies that were on top of the wall, in my sights.
I missed the flaggies but run over the teddy bear that they left behind!
After this I spoke to a member of the CAMS (Crimes against Motor Sport) track safety committee and said that I was not happy with the way the concrete wall was sloped to launch the cars up onto it and also the way the flaggies were exposed with no escape route (big drop behind them) and within a decade they fixed it!(no point rushing into it

This happened at Bathurst in 1995 Ask Les Robards (If you know him) he was one of the flaggies that I nearly run over!
